Default it is my birthday and OH CRAP i somehow cracked a wheel

well i noticed this morning that my tire was flat, so i took it off to check it out. i found a crack on the inside of the rim that starts at the tire and goes towards the center of the wheel(about 1 inch long). i searched but couldn't find a good answer: is this wheel toast now or is there any way to fix it?

Default Re: it is my birthday and OH CRAP i somehow cracked a wheel

sometimes you can get a crack like that cleaned up and welded but it can be costly and impractial as well as your wheel may have other issues if it cracked from heat/oldage/etc (more damage soon.... ticking timebomb) instead of just one curbage.
